1. Authentic Content Over Perfect Production
In 2026, authenticity continues to outperform polish. Users are increasingly drawn to creators and brands that show real moments, honest opinions, and behind-the-scenes insights.
Highly edited, overly scripted videos are losing effectiveness, especially when compared to casual, conversational clips filmed on mobile devices. This shift reflects a broader trend toward user-focused content, where value and relatability matter more than visual perfection.

2. AI-Assisted Creation and Personalization
Artificial intelligence is playing a growing role in short-form video creation. In 2026, creators are using AI tools to:
-
Generate captions and hooks
-
Optimize video length and pacing
-
Personalize content recommendations
-
Analyze engagement patterns

3. Platform-Specific Content Strategies
One of the biggest mistakes creators make is posting the same video everywhere without adaptation. In 2026, successful short-form strategies are platform-specific:
-
TikTok favors trends, challenges, and raw storytelling
-
Instagram Reels performs best with lifestyle, branding, and aesthetics
-
YouTube Shorts rewards educational and evergreen content

5. Educational Micro-Content Is Rising
In 2026, viewers are not just entertainedโthey want to learn quickly. Short tutorials, tips, and explainers perform exceptionally well, especially when they solve a specific problem in under 60 seconds.

Risks and Considerations in 2026
Despite its power, short-form video comes with challenges:
-
High competition across platforms
-
Rapidly changing trends
-
Risk of burnout without a clear strategy
-
Over-commercialization that reduces trust
Avoid chasing every trend. Instead, align video efforts with your core brand message and content ecosystem, including blogs and long-form resources.
